Nestled in the sought-after Hoe area of Plymouth, this impressive five-bedroom terrace period property in St. James Place West presents a fantastic opportunity for families seeking spacious and stylish living within easy reach of the iconic Plymouth Hoe and Barbican.

Arranged over three floors, this property boasts a wealth of appealing features, including a contemporary open-plan lounge/diner, a brand new kitchen, and a luxurious master suite. There is parking for one vehicle at the rear, and an electric garage door.

Property Description

Step inside to discover a warm and inviting atmosphere, with a seamless flow between the main living spaces. The spacious lounge/diner offers a versatile layout, ideal for both relaxed family living and entertaining guests. It can remain open plan for a modern feel or be separated into distinct rooms using the original large folding doors, adding character and flexibility. Natural light floods the area, enhancing the bright and airy ambiance throughout, with double patio doors offering access to the rear courtyard.

The newly fitted kitchen is a true highlight, featuring sleek modern units, integrated appliances, Belfast sink, and ample worktop space and an area for dining.

Ascending to the upper floors, you'll find five well-proportioned bedrooms and three bathroom/shower rooms, offering plenty of space for a growing family or visiting guests.

The substantial master bedroom is a particular treat, boasting an en-suite bath and shower room and a desirable walk-in wardrobe, providing a touch of luxury and convenience.

Outside, the property benefits from an enclosed courtyard which is ideal space for entertaining and a garden shed.

A significant advantage in this central location is the off-road parking space, providing secure and convenient parking accessed by remote controlled garage door.

Location is key, and this property truly excels. Located in a quieter road, in walking distance to the vibrant Plymouth Hoe, residents can easily enjoy stunning sea views, open green spaces, and a variety of local amenities, including cafes, restaurants, and shops.

The property's PL1 3AT postcode ensures excellent transport links and access to the city centre.

This substantial terrace house offers a wonderful blend of period charm and modern living, making it an ideal family home in a highly desirable Plymouth location.
